My character is Bard/Marshal that just hit level 15 (10brd/5mar).  I have already decided to level up the bard class as that will allow access to 4th level spells.  I have completely and totally embraced the support role (most of my spells are of the "buff an individual or the party" or "re-roll dice" variety,  I have a weapon and have never used it and the only offensive ability I have and use is the Doomspeak feat).  The question is what feat to take next.

 

I have the following:

Combat Expertise

Skill Focus (Diplomacy) [bard class feature]

Extra Music

Extra Music

Subsonics

Lyric Spell

Doomspeak

 

With my CHA as high as it is I already get 18 bardic music uses per day.  But another Extra Music is not out of the question (last two sessions (representing one day of adventuring) the party had no chance to rest and so I actually used all of my bardic music uses in that one day, but that is an exception; all previous sessions, since I created the character, I never got close to using all my bardic music)

 

I thought about the Dimensional Jaunt (Reserve) feat.  Since I just got access to 4th level spells I can learn dimension door and be able to use the DJ feat.  My reasoning behind this is that it would give me a way to get out of harm's way (only having 87HP and AC27 (with combat expertise) makes me squishy)

 

I thought about the Obtain Familiar feat but the risks outweigh the benefits.

 

Any feat from any official published source is acceptable.

You're missing pretty much all of the Inspire Courage support feats - Song of the Heart (EbCS), Words of Creation (BoED), Dragonfire Inspiration (Dragon Magic - this gets much deadlier if you've got a sonic-type dragon heritage (Battle Dragon is a perfect thematic fit) and combine it with the Creaking Cacophony (Spell Compendium) spell), and so on. Of these, Words of Creation easily has the biggest benefit as a single feat, but also has the highest ability score requirements. Song of the Heart is the least intrusive, if you worry about overshadowing.

 

Don't worry about Dimensional Jaunt. Handle your defenses with equipment. I'd specifically suggest a Shadow Cloak (Drow of the Underdark) and Tome of Battle equipment (the Iron Heart Vest linked to Wall of Blades is a great last-ditch defense, arguably much better than raising your AC and certainly more cost-effective with your buffs).

 

Also, buy a Vest of Legends (DMG2) and Badge of Valor (MIC - the rest of the set isn't bad either if you've committed to using marshal) if you haven't already, and look into wands of Inspirational Boost (SpC).

Beyond Words of Creation, and Song of the Heart - you also should be using equipment to completely push that optimization to the limit:

 

Badge of Valor (Magic Item Compendium)

Masterwork Instruments:

Drums: +1 to the bonus to damage w/ Inspire Courage, but -1 to the bonus vs charm and fear.

Fiddle: +1 to the bonus vs charm and fear w/ Inspire Courage. If you have 5 or more ranks in Perform (Dance) the bonus increases to +2.

Flute: +2 to countersong checks)

Harp:  +1 target additional creature with Fascinate and Inspire Greatness

Horn: +1 to the bonus to damage and save vs fear w/ Inspire Courage, but the effect ends 1 round after the recipient can no longer hear the bard toot.

Lute: +1 level to determining effectiveness of bardic music.


Mandolin: +1 to the attack roll bonus w/ Inspire Courage, but -1 to everything else (damage, save vs charm/fear).

Mandolin is really good with Dragonfire Inspiration. A Lute will combine well with a Vest of Legends to always put you one full step ahead with Inspire Courage. When you get to Inspire Greatness the Harp's pretty nice I must say.

 

I've always played bards that keep both hands busy, so no instruments for me, but the bonu's are quite good.
